Management Meeting Minutes — Lease Renegotiation

Attendees: branch leadership, facilities.

The Farrow Street lease expires in March. Landlord proposed a 9% increase; we countered flat with a three-year term. Facilities to obtain comparable rates in the Welden district by next meeting. Branch managers: defer any fit-out spending until terms settle. Relocation remains a fallback, not a preference. Decision targeted for month-end. The confidential negotiating position is noted below.

confidential, kagup-bafog: Fraaxax Group is in early talks to buy Soroxox Group for about $343.8 million. The Olidor launch date is June 14, and nothing goes to the press before then. Legal wants the Aldmirek Logistics term sheet signed before July 23.

Q: How do I regain admin access to StormRelay, the weather-alert fan-out, if the primary operator account is lost?

A: StormRelay has no self-service reset. Maintainers must use the sealed recovery flow: stop the fan-out workers, start the broker in recovery mode, and answer the passphrase prompt. The broker accepts one attempt per restart. The current recovery passphrase is given below.

strongbox words: norwyn-wenael-aldvan-aldiel-wendor-holael

## Fixturecraft Release Runbook — Cut Release

Freeze main. Bump version in `fixturecraft.toml`. Run the full generator suite twice; flaky seeds must be pinned, not skipped. Build wheels for all supported runtimes. Smoke-test the factory registry against the Stagingyard snapshot. Draft release notes from merged changelog fragments. Confirm no test-data schemas changed without a migration note. Upload artifacts to the internal index only after checksums match. Sign the final bundle with the release key provided below.

deploy key for fahip-hahig: bky9_h7SNaFcjv

Subject: DR Drill — Fixturegrove Restore Steps

Team, during next week's disaster-recovery drill we will rebuild the Fixturegrove test-data factory library from cold backups. Follow the restore script in order and verify seed determinism before signing off. To unlock the sealed drill archive, use the recovery passphrase provided directly below this message.

recovery phrase for bawep-kawef: oliath-casdor